Реферат Курсовая Конспект
КОНСПЕКТ ЛЕКЦИЙ по дисциплине Операционные системы - Конспект Лекций, раздел Науковедение, Министерство Образования Украины Восточноукраинский Государственный ...
|
МИНИСТЕРСТВО ОБРАЗОВАНИЯ УКРАИНЫ
ВОСТОЧНОУКРАИНСК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ИТЕТ
Северодонецкий технологический институт
КОНСПЕКТ ЛЕКЦИЙ
по дисциплине
“Операционные системы ”
для студентов, обучающихся по направлению 6.0915 «Компьютерная инженерия» специальности 7.091501 «Компьютерные сети и системы»
Утверждено
На заседании кафедры
компьютерной инженерии
протокол № от________
Составил Е. В. Щербаков
введение
Операционные системы параллельной обработки информации применяются в следующих основных типах вычислительных систем:
1. В однопроцессорных компьютерах.
2. В многопроцессорных компьютерах с общей оперативной памятью, имеющих несколько устройств управления и арифметико-логических устройств. Такие системы могут обрабатывать одновременно несколько потоков команд над различными данными.
3. На многомашинных комплексах и сетях, состоящих из многих вычислительных машин, в том числе и микропроцессоров, объединённых общими каналами связи, по которым осуществляется обмен информацией. Такие операционные системы называются распределенными.
Принципиальное отличие распределенных операционных систем от традиционных централизованных заключается в управлении несколькими одновременно выполняемыми процессами, обрабатывающими информацию, средствами передачи сообщений между этими процессами и средствами синхронизации этих процессов.
При работе однопроцессорных и многопроцессорных компьютеров возникают четыре различных вида параллелизма вычислительных процессов:
1) между потоками внутри одного процесса (задачи);
2) между потоками, принадлежащими различным процессам;
3) между потоками процесса пользователя, с одной стороны, и потоками операционной системы - с другой;
4) между потоками самой операционной системы.
В распределенных операционных системах появляется ряд функций, не свойственных операционным системам однопроцессорных вычислительных машин. К ним относятся: инициация и завершение параллельно протекающих потоков и процессов, обмен сообщениями между ними, их синхронизация, а также распределение вычислительных ресурсов для самой распределенной операционной системы.
В распределенных операционных системах усложняется решение или приобретает большее значение ряд проблем, имеющих место в традиционных операционных системах однопроцессорных машин. К таким проблемам относятся, например, распределение ресурсов между задачами и процессами, опасность возникновения тупиков, проблема понижения реактивности систем и некоторые др.
– Конец работы –
Используемые теги: Конспект, лекций, дисциплине, операционные, системы0.085
Если Вам нужно дополнительный материал на эту тему, или Вы не нашли то, что искали, рекомендуем воспользоваться поиском по нашей базе работ: КОНСПЕКТ ЛЕКЦИЙ по дисциплине Операционные системы
Если этот материал оказался полезным для Вас, Вы можете сохранить его на свою страничку в социальных сетях:
Твитнуть |
Новости и инфо для студентов